What is recorded here

In rough undulating, rush-covered, hill pasture, on a W-facing slope and within an area of relict field boundaries (CO115-060----). The largely grass-covered remains of a circular cairn (diam. 3.4m; H 0.4m), comprising stones of varying shape and size, features traces of kerbing along its W arc. There is a hut site (CO115-060008-) 3m to the E. The above description is derived from 'The Archaeological Inventory of County Cork. Volume 5' (Dublin: Stationery Office, 2009).
